False Eyelashes
False eyelashes, otherwise known as “falsies” are the newest and latest trends. Many people like to use false eyelashes to help enhance and open their eyes up to appear larger or more cat eye like in photos. According to Allure eyelash guide, “the look of endless, fluttery lashes aren’t going out of style any time soon.”
There are different kinds of lashes, such as individual lashes, strip lashes, mink lashes, and eyelash extensions. I will briefly go over what these lashes are and how they can be applied or worn.
Individual lashes: These lashes are cut up versions of strip lashes, they are put on the eyelashes one by one. This gives off a more natural lash look for your eyes.
Strip lashes: These lashes are a whole bunch of individual lashes, glued in clusters on one band. This makes for an easy application. This style of lash comes in either mink or faux hair and you can either achieve a dramatic or butterfly look.
Mink lashes: These lashes are made from real hair, and usually last longer in terms of wear. Mink lashes can last up to 20 wears, as for strips and individual lashes can last up to 3-5 times. Mink lashes are usually glued on a tougher band.
Eyelash extensions: These type of lashes can’t be put on by yourself. These are semi permanent lashes that you get done with a beauty esthetician. These lashes are glued on each lash and last up to 2-3 weeks without having to remove them. These are harder to manage because you can’t get them wet within the first 24 hours of getting them done, and after that you want to make sure you thoroughly wash them, as bacteria can start to grow.
